Overcast


The weather forecast headlines rain

Though it’s only rain at nine

The rest of the day is fine

But the forecast depicts a downfall

All doom and gloomy

Like the news

Where all we get is overcast

Shading over our sunny lives

Rustling up storms in our teacups

With debatable.

HEADLINES

Become blurbs

Like movies are reality

Sold on vanity

With no time to forage for thoughts

Preferring them ready made

Heated up by the media

Served as tv dinners

Filling a whole for instant gratification

Parasites bloating on schadenfreude

Through not face to face bookishness

Absorbing the life of others

Bed bugs biting through a good nights sleep

Until we left wondering

Whether to wrap ourselves up

Or let it all hang out




Admiration


They say you should never meet your idols


I look closely at the Turner in the gallery

A painting I’ve adored from afar

Admiring the masterstrokes

The depictions of man embroiled in nature

Saturated in a plethora of colour

Through impassioned intensity


Now I’m before it in the flesh

Scrutinising it in juxtaposition

Noticing all the minor strokes

The blotches and blemishes

All rising to the surface

Like starch in cold broth.
